SSP America is a leading operator of food and beverage establishments, renowned for its diverse restaurant portfolio at Portland International Airport (PDX). Their collection includes popular destinations such as Deschutes Brewery, Hopworks Urban Brewery, Juliett, Good Coffee, Oven & Shaker, among others. Known for combining quality craft beverages with innovative and delicious food offerings, SSP America strives to deliver exceptional guest experiences through every venue. Each restaurant within the portfolio offers a unique ambiance and culinary style that caters to a wide range of tastes and preferences, ensuring there is something for every traveler or local patron to enjoy.

SSP America is currently seeking enthusiastic and skilled Bartenders to join their team full-time. This role is integral to the company’s commitment to guest satisfaction, requiring individuals who are not only experienced in bartending but also able to engage warmly with guests, providing excellent service in a fast-paced environment. The position offers a competitive hourly wage of $16.30 plus tips, along with a full benefits package, set schedules, and additional perks such as a free monthly TriMet pass or free employee parking. Candidates must have open availability in the mornings, including weekends, as this is crucial to meeting the demands of the restaurant operations.

As a Bartender at SSP America, you will be responsible for greeting guests promptly with courtesy and friendliness, mixing and presenting drinks exactly to recipe specifications while practicing portion control, and operating the point of sale system accurately to process guest orders and payments. The role also includes handling cash transactions, ensuring all charges and vouchers are correctly recorded, and maintaining the bar’s cleanliness and organization to the highest standards. Adherence to state, federal, and company liquor regulations is paramount, particularly regarding the responsible service of alcoholic beverages to minors and intoxicated guests, thereby ensuring safety and compliance with legal and corporate policies.

The ideal candidate will bring at least one year of bartending experience, confidence, and knowledge of beverage preparation techniques.
